"Suicidal" by Florida rapper YNW Melly peaked at No.13 on Billboard Hot 100 in January. Melly has been unable to promote the song for some time — in February 2019, he was arrested and accused of murdering his associates Anthony "YNW Sakchaser" Williams and Christopher "YNW Juv" Thomas Jr.
"Suicidal" was boosted on the charts after a wave of virality on TikTok, and this Friday, Melly will share the song's official remix featuring Juice WRLD. See the announcement below:

YNW Melly has tested positive for COVID-19 while in a Florida jail, the Florida rapper’s official Instagram account claims. He’s currently awaiting trial in a Broward County jail after being charged with two counts of first-degree murder. The rapper’s team announced plans to file a motion for restricted release. Though YNW Melly remains incarcerated on double murder charges, his musical output hasn't wavered. On Tuesday (March 24), the embattled star released the video for his "Suicidal (Remix)," featuring the late Juice WRLD.
